Willersley Ave/Halfway St Junction

12.00.00am BST (GMT +0100) Sat 23rd Oct 2004

Labour-run Bexley Council are proposing a roundabout at the Willersley Ave/Halfway St junction.

Your Lib Dem team believe this is unworkable. It wouldn't slow approaching traffi c sufficiently. The through road to Hollies Avenue is essential, if we are not to create a NO-GO area for ordinary residents. A better solution would be traffic lights.
